OpenCBM
Data Structures
Here are the data structures with brief descriptions:
 C_ARCH_DEVICE_EXTENSION
 Ccbmcopy_settings
 CCBMT_BOOLEAN
 CCBMT_I_INSTALL_OUT
 CCBMT_I_TESTIRQ
 CCBMT_IEC_DBG_VALUE
 CCBMT_IECADDRESS
 CCBMT_LINE
 CCBMT_LINESTATE
 CCBMT_SINGLEBYTE
 Cd64copy_settings
 Cd64copy_status
 Cd82copy_settings
 Cd82copy_status
 CDEVICE_EXTENSION_s
 CENUMERATE_NT4
 CENUMERATE_WDM
 CIEC_TIMEOUTS
 Cimgcopy_settings
 Cimgcopy_status
 Cinput_reader
 CInstallPluginCallback_context_s@@@
 CNTSTATUS_DEBUGCODE
 Copencbm_configuration_entry_s
 Copencbm_configuration_s
 Copencbm_configuration_section_s
 Copencbm_plugin_sHolds all callbacks of the plugin
 Coption
 COPTIONSStruct to remember the general options to the program
 CPARBURST_RW_VALUE
 Cplugin_information_s@@@
 Cplugin_read_pointer
 Cplugin_read_pointer_group
 Cprog
 CQUEUEA QUEUE object A QUEUE object is an object which can be used to queue IRPs for processing. This QUEUE object is optimized for being polled from an own worker thread. Anyway, a concept called FastStart is also implemented, which allows some IRPs to be completed immediately, without being queued, if no IRP is executed yet and the caller has stated that he wants this IRP to be started fast if possible
 CSETUPAPI
 Ctransfer_funcs
 Cusb_bus
 Cusb_config_descriptor
 Cusb_ctrl_setup
 Cusb_descriptor_header
 Cusb_device
 Cusb_device_descriptor
 Cusb_dll_s
 Cusb_endpoint_descriptor
 Cusb_hid_descriptor
 Cusb_interface
 Cusb_interface_descriptor
 Cusb_string_descriptor
 Cusb_version
 Cxa1541_parameter_sThe parameter which are given on the command-line
 Cxu1541_parameter_sThe parameter which are given on the command-line